Crawlspace waterproofing services focus on preventing water from infiltrating the area beneath a building’s main floors. This process typically involves installing drainage systems, vapor barriers, and sump pumps to manage excess moisture and keep the space dry. By addressing water intrusion early, property owners can protect their foundations and improve indoor air quality, as damp crawlspaces often lead to mold growth and musty odors. Professional contractors evaluate the specific needs of each property to recommend the most effective waterproofing solutions.
Water in crawlspaces can cause a variety of problems, including structural damage, mold development, and increased energy costs. When moisture is allowed to accumulate, it can weaken the foundation over time and create an environment conducive to pests and allergens. Waterproofing services help mitigate these issues by sealing leaks, improving drainage, and controlling humidity levels. These measures not only preserve the integrity of the property but also promote a healthier living or working environment.

Discover typical Crawlspace Waterproofing project ranges for Holland, OH.
Cost Range - Crawlspace waterproofing services typically cost between $1,500 and $4,000, depending on the size of the area and the extent of work needed. Larger or more complex projects may exceed this range, especially in regions like Holland, OH.
Factors Affecting Price - Costs can vary based on the type of waterproofing method chosen, such as interior sealants or exterior drainage systems. Additional services like sump pump installation may add to the overall expense.
Average Expenses - Homeowners often spend around $2,000 to $3,500 for comprehensive crawlspace waterproofing, which includes moisture barriers, drainage, and sealing measures. Prices may fluctuate based on local contractor rates and specific project requirements.
Cost Variability - The final cost depends on the crawlspace size, existing conditions, and selected waterproofing solutions. It is advisable to obtain quotes from local service providers for accurate pricing tailored to individual needs.

What is crawlspace waterproofing? Crawlspace waterproofing involves sealing and protecting the area beneath a building to prevent moisture intrusion, which can help reduce mold, wood rot, and structural issues.
Why should I consider crawlspace waterproofing? Waterproofing can help control humidity, prevent water damage, and improve indoor air quality by reducing dampness and mold growth in the crawlspace area.
What methods are used for crawlspace waterproofing? Local service providers may use techniques such as installing vapor barriers, sump pumps, exterior drainage systems, and sealing cracks to keep the crawlspace dry.
How can I tell if my crawlspace needs waterproofing? Signs include persistent dampness, mold growth, a musty odor, or visible water accumulation in the crawlspace area.
